Title: Stephen Hong-Wei Wu: Innovator in Polymer Science
Introduction: Stephen Hong-Wei Wu is an accomplished inventor based in Kingsport, Tennessee, recognized for his contributions to polymer science. With a focus on innovative processes, he has secured two patents that enhance the production and application of polymeric materials.
Latest Patents: Wu's latest patents highlight his expertise in polymer technology. The first patent, titled "Process for Production of Polymeric Powders," describes a novel method for preparing polymers with an average particle size of less than about 40 micrometers. This process involves dissolving a polymer in a solvent to form a solution, which is then introduced into an agitating aqueous medium.
The second patent, "Liquid Crystalline Phase Drug Delivery Vehicle," presents a unique composition that comprises 55 to 90 weight percent of a monoglyceride component, along with an acetylated monoglyceride component and water. This composition exhibits liquid crystalline characteristics, functioning optimally at temperatures between 20 to 80°C, preferably in a cubic liquid crystalline gel form.
